Mia St. John’s dedication extends beyond her accomplishments in the boxing ring and her sobriety.

She is equally known for her efforts to raise awareness about mental health. Motivated by her own experiences of sorrow and grief, she has further committed herself wholeheartedly to this cause. Acknowledging her influence, she channels it towards aiding young children facing mental disorders, homelessness, and addiction.
